About this center

Western Pacific Re Hab — Western Pacific Fullerton RH is an addiction treatment provider in Fullerton, California. According to the public treatment facility listing record for this address, the program offers both residential and outpatient services, covering medical detox, outpatient program, medication-assisted treatment (mat), and opioid treatment program (otp), among 5 listed levels of care.

The same record identifies treatment for substance use disorder, opioid use disorder, co-occurring disorders / dual diagnosis, trauma / ptsd, and chronic pain. Programming is listed as serving active duty military, adolescents, adults, co-occurring disorders / dual diagnosis, and court-ordered clients. Services are listed as available in English, ASL / Sign Language, Spanish, Chinese, Arabic, Farsi / Persian, German, Japanese, Russian, Tagalog, and Vietnamese.

Listed accreditation and treatment approaches include 12-Step Facilitation, Anger Management, Brief Intervention, Buprenorphine, and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T).
